A straight edge is more useful when it can stand on its own.
When you’re checking a table saw, jointer, router table, or other machine surface, one hand on the straight edge can get in the way of the inspection. The reference needs to stay put while you look for gaps, humps, or dips.
The Woodpeckers SERX Straight Edge Rule is built for that kind of setup work.
Its inverted vee-groove profile creates a freestanding reference, while the bright white edge helps make low spots easier to see.
• Freestanding profile helps during flatness and alignment checks
• Machined to .0015" per foot for machinery setup work
• Bright white bottom edge helps reveal low spots
• 30° beveled scale brings graduations closer to the work
• Precisely machined and carefully inspected in Strongsville, Ohio
